Output add958613906ce5c8a7814dd17a4b50f94d0f8ec6517646826b3b16c6af155f2:5

value
106909275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aad0a07dc06fff694dcdbbabb8e98a218908f47 OP_EQUAL
address
MDFQiXfaBbQudNKMrprHueU2tTbdADr3F2
transaction
add958613906ce5c8a7814dd17a4b50f94d0f8ec6517646826b3b16c6af155f2
spent
true